Equivalent & Substitute Parts for Keystone Electronics 6016
Part Overview
The Keystone Electronics 6016 is a tip jack connector designed for standard tip applications with panel mount configuration and turret termination. This component is classified as obsolete, necessitating identification of functionally equivalent alternatives for ongoing procurement and system maintenance. The substitute part maintains core electrical and mechanical compatibility while offering active product status and improved availability.

Key Parameters
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Manufacturer Part Number | 6016 |
| Manufacturer | Keystone Electronics |
| Category | Banana and Tip Connectors |
| Type | Tip Jack |
| Gender | Female |
| Plug/Mating Plug Diameter | Standard Tip |
| Mounting Type | Panel Mount |
| Termination | Turret |
| Insulation | Mating End Insulated, Metal Clad |
| Color | Yellow |
| Contact Finish | Gold |
| Contact Material | Beryllium Copper |
| Body Material | Polyamide (PA), Nylon |
| Product Status | Obsolete |
| RoHS Status | ROHS3 Compliant |
| Moisture Sensitivity Level (MSL) | 1 (Unlimited) |
| REACH Status | REACH Unaffected |
Substitute Part Grouping Explanation
Substitution of the Keystone Electronics 6016 is based on the following critical parameters that define functional equivalence:
- Connector Type: Tip Jack (Female gender)
- Mating Interface: Standard Tip diameter
- Color Specification: Yellow
- Regulatory Compliance: RoHS and REACH requirements
- Moisture Sensitivity: MSL 1 classification
The identified substitute, Cinch Connectivity Solutions Johnson 105-0207-200, satisfies these core substitution criteria. Both components function as female tip jack connectors with standard tip mating interfaces and yellow color designation. Both maintain MSL 1 moisture sensitivity classification and comply with applicable regulatory frameworks.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What makes the Cinch 105-0207-200 a suitable substitute for the Keystone 6016?
A: Both components are female tip jack connectors with standard tip mating interfaces and yellow color designation. They share identical MSL 1 moisture sensitivity classification and equivalent RoHS compliance status, ensuring functional and environmental compatibility.
Q: Are there differences in mounting or termination between these parts?
A: The Keystone 6016 specifies panel mount configuration with turret termination. The Cinch 105-0207-200 does not specify these parameters in the available data. Physical verification of mounting compatibility is necessary for applications with specific mounting requirements.
Q: Does the substitute maintain the same contact material and finish specifications?
A: The Keystone 6016 specifies beryllium copper contact material with gold finish. The Cinch 105-0207-200 does not provide contact material or finish specifications in the available data. Contact the manufacturer for detailed material specifications if these properties are critical to your application.
